In other data news, on April 20th, GCN published an interesting article entitled, How one state measures post-pandemic recovery. In this article, Stephanie Kanowitz describes how economic leaders in New Jersey can now see indicators and contextualize metrics with a solution that combines government, geographic and third-party economic data into an interactive dashboard.
- “The state went live last month with Tyler Technologies’ Economic Intelligence solution, which combines consumer spending, mobility, and small-business data from aggregators such as SafeGraph and Affinity Solutions with existing data on permitting, business licensing, and property and sales tax revenue collection, for instance, in Tyler’s Data and Insights platform. To be useful, the data must be up-to-date and granular, meaning at the industry-sector level. ‘Are people in our community spending their money on retail? Are they spending it on health and fitness?’ said Saf Rabah, vice president of data solutions at Tyler.”
